Preschoolers' serial matching of picture lists composed of either phonetically similar or unrelated items was compared under three types of conditions. The lower retention of phonetic lists had been used as an index of verbal mediation by Conrad (1971, 1972) who found that preschoolers did not show differential retention, and hence no verbal encoding, even when they were required to label overtly. This result was replicated and also obtained in a condition which emphasized the verbal aspects of the task. However, a significant phonetic effect and higher overall retention resulted from a condition which required overt, cumulative rehearsal. Alternative interpretations of the influence of rehearsal on the phonetic effect were offered.  相似文献

This paper examines a crucial problem facing a bargainer in interpersonal negotiation; should he seek additional information about an opponent's reward structure. The “information is weakness” hypothesis and the “reality of aspiration” hypothesis give conflicting recommendations concerning this question. An “information-aspiration” model is presented as an explanation of why the findings which give support to both positions are not necessarily contradictory. This model is tested in a 2 × 2 factorial design where 80 buyers bargained having either complete or incomplete information and low or high aspiration levels, against 80 sellers with incomplete information. In general the model was supported in that bargainers with low aspirations tended to gain strength with additional information, while those with high aspirations tended to lose strength with additional information.  相似文献

Dorfman and Biderman evaluated an additive-operator learning model and some special cases of this model on data from a signal-detection experiment. They found that Kac's pure error-correction model gave the poorest fit of the special models when the predictions were generated from the maximum likelihood estimates and the initial cutoffs were set at an a priori value rather than estimated. First, this paper presents tests of an asymptotic theorem by Norman, which provide strong support for Kac's model. On the final 100 trials, every subject but one gave probability matching, and the response propcrtions appropriately normed were approximately normally distributed with variance π(1 ? π). Further analyses of the Dorfman-Biderman data based upon maximum likelihood and likelihood-ratio tests suggest that Kac's model gives a relatively good, but imperfect fit to the data. Some possible explanations for the apparent contradiction between the results of these new analyses and the original findings of Dorfman and Biderman were explored. The investigations led to the proposal that there may be nonsystematic, random drifts in the decision criterion after correct responses as well as after errors. The hypothesis gives a minor modification of the conclusions from Norman's theorem for Kac's model. It gives asymptotic probability matching for every subject, but a larger asymptotic variance than π(1 ? π), which agrees with the data. The paper also presents good Monte Carlo justification for the use of maximum likelihood and likelihood-ratio tests with these additive learning models. Results from Thomas' nonparametric test of error correction are presented, which are inconclusive. Computation of Thomas' p statistic on the Monte Carlo simulations showed that it is quite variable and insensitive to small deviations from error correction.  相似文献

Two experiments investigating the effect of the direction of a relational judgment on the speed of the judgment are reported. In both experiments, college students required more time to select the smaller of a pair of large animals than to select the larger. Conversely, the smaller of a pair of small animals was selected more quickly than was the larger. The magnitude of this “cross-over effect” was fully graded, increasing regularly with extremity, but the variability of the response times in each direction was unrelated to extremity. Individual animals were classified as “small” or “large” with almost perfect consistency. This pattern of results is used to evaluate several models of relational judgment; of these, the congruency model is shown to be inconsistent with these data.

This paper proposed a two-stage model to capture some basic relations between attention, comprehension and memory for sentences. According to the model, the first stage of linguistic processing is carried out in short-term memory (M1) and involves a superficial analysis of semantic and syntactic features of words. The second stage is carried out in long-term memory (M2) and involves application of transformational rules to the analyses of M1 so as to determine the deep or underlying relations among words and phrases. According to the theory, attention is an M2 process: preliminary analyses by M1 are carried out even for unattended inputs, but final analyses by M2 are only carried out for attended inputs. The theory was shown to be consistent with established facts concerning memory, attention and comprehension, and additional support for the theory was obtained in a series of dichotic listening experiments.  相似文献

During three sessions, each of 24 Ss responded to noxious thermal stimuli, using the following judgments: binary decision, S responded “high” or “low”; sensory intensity rating, S rated his sensory experience along a thermal intensity continuum; and concurrent report, S’s binary decision was followed by an intensity rating. The binary-decision d’ was significantly higher than the rating d′, suggesting that Ss could not maintain multiple thermal criteria in a consistent fashion. The criteria for pain obtained with single and concurrent intensity rating judgments did not differ. These results suggest that the most efficacious and valid method for the study of experimental pain is to obtain concurrent responses, and to use binary decisions to compute d’ and sensory intensity ratings to locate S’s criterion for reporting pain.  相似文献
